How far is POA from ROC?

The flight distance from Porto Alegre (POA) to Rochester (ROC) is 5,324 miles (8,568 km, 4,626 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from POA to ROC?

A nonstop flight takes about 10h 54m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Porto Alegre and Rochester?

Rochester is 1 hour behind Porto Alegre.
